Bosnia and Herzegovina's cloud computing landscape is rapidly evolving, with 15 active cloud providers supporting local businesses. The enterprise adoption rate has reached 62%, driven by digital transformation initiatives and government incentives to modernize IT infrastructure. Businesses are allocating an average of €27,500 annually to cloud services, reflecting growing confidence in cloud solutions for operational efficiency and scalability.
A significant 48% of organizations employ multi-cloud strategies, aiming to optimize performance and mitigate risks. Investments in local data centers and cloud infrastructure are estimated at $120 million, indicating strong governmental and private sector commitment to digital growth. This trend enhances Bosnia and Herzegovina's position as a regional digital hub, encouraging innovation and economic development.
